Cursive Gime 12 is a very light, narrow, medium contrast, italic, very short x-height font.

A delicate cursive script with fine, hairline strokes and a consistent rightward slant. Letterforms are built from long, flowing curves and open counters, with frequent entry/exit strokes that suggest continuous handwriting. Capitals are tall and ornate with generous loops and occasional extended arms, while lowercase forms stay small and light, emphasizing a pronounced height contrast between cases. Spacing feels loose and breathable, and the overall texture is thin and sparkling rather than dense.

This script works best for display settings where its thin strokes and swashy capitals can be appreciated—wedding stationery, invitations, beauty or boutique branding, labels, and signature-style logotypes. It’s especially effective for short headlines, monograms, and name-focused compositions rather than long passages of small text.

The font conveys a poised, romantic tone—more like careful penmanship than casual marker writing. Its light touch and looping shapes read as intimate and formal-leaning, with a gentle, decorative flair suited to names and short statements.

The design appears intended to mimic elegant, looped handwriting with a light pen stroke, prioritizing grace and movement over utilitarian readability. Its tall, expressive capitals and restrained lowercase suggest a font built for refined personalization and decorative titling.

Several capitals rely on prominent swashes and delicate hairpins, creating a strong visual hierarchy and making leading/tracking important for clarity. Numerals are slender and simple, matching the script’s light rhythm and maintaining an understated presence alongside the letters.
